同学,你好,我没有完全理解你的问题,
1、建立结构的话,我推荐使用MS软件吧,很方便的,如果你们实验室没有购买,可以再小木虫上找找有破解版的,哈哈,版本嘛都无所谓的
2、对与层错结构的建立,可以使用MS切面,然后将所切面做成3D结构,需要的话,再做成supercell,最后将你截得的两个或者多个这样的结构连接起来,连接的时候注意中间真空层的设置,可以设置一系列厚度,经行能量计算后,拟合得到最优的厚度值,进而展开进一步的计算。愿分享我自己的方法:
希望能给你的仿真模拟带来帮助,下面是具体的操作步骤:
1)MS切面,
用MS打开你要研究的结构,Build--Surfaces--Cleave Surface,在弹出的对话框中Cleave plane(h k l )一栏中,选择你所要切的晶面,最后选择Cleave就可以了;
2)将截面做成3D结构,
将所得截面打开,添加真空层,Build--Crystal--Build Vacuum Slab Crystal,真空层厚度Vacuum thickness一般按照结构周期修改,也可以选择0,最后Build就可以了;
3)建立supercell,
这一步比较简单,打开得到的3D结构,Build--Symmetry--Supercell,在弹出的对话框中,选择三个方向上的扩展就可以了;
4)同样的方法取得另一个截面的3Dsupercell;
5)连接两个supercell,
将两个supercell都打开,Build--Build Layers,在弹出的对话框中,将两个supercell添加到Layer 1,Layer2中,接着选择Layers Details --修改相应的Vacuum值,来得到一系列不同间隔的结构,最后Build就可以了;
6)对不同的结构计算能量,得到最后结构,继续下面的计算吧,
注意:结构的周期性问题,还有晶体结构的变形问题,望有用,
|